This class represents the elementwise operation \(\log(1 + e^x)\). This is a special case of log(sum(exp)) that evaluates to a vector rather than to a scalar, which is useful for logistic regression.

to_numeric
: Evaluates e^x
elementwise, adds one, and takes the natural logarithm.
sign_from_args
: The atom is positive.
is_atom_convex
: The atom is convex.
is_atom_concave
: The atom is not concave.
is_incr
: The atom is weakly increasing.
is_decr
: The atom is not weakly decreasing.
